Reducibility and Generalized Reducibility of Linear Differential Systems with a Real Multiplier Parameter

Abstract We construct a pair of mutually reducible linear differential systems with bounded continuous coefficients on the time half-line with the following property: there exists a countable set of real numbers such that, for each number in this set, the systems obtained by multiplying the coefficient matrices of the original systems by that number cannot be reduced to each other but are reducible to each other in the generalized sense.
